Can anyone site any advantages to having more than one database per ORACLE instance, other than saving shared memory (SGA) ?

The UNIX administrators here want me to include ALL of my DBs in one instance. Currently, I have two medium-size DBs and one little data warehouse which someday will become a big warehouse.

I tend to find more disadvantges than pluses: single point of failure if instance dies, taking database down for maintenance effects ALL apps, not being able to taylor an instance to a specific app, etc.
